REMINDER - REGISTRATION TONIGHT!
Registration for the 2017/2018 season is now open.  

Please be reminded that the early bird deadline for registration pricing is TODAY!

TONIGHT is the last in person registration session before prices increase.  Register from 5pm to 7pm at the new community information center located on the Main Street in Grand Valley.

In order to register for next season you will need to bring the following with you:

~ Registration form signed and completed in full (you can also pick up a form tonight and fill out in person)
~ Copy of a Birth Certificate of your player(s) if they are new to Grand Valley Minor Hockey
~ Cash or Cheque for payment (payment plans are available)
~ Volunteer Bond Agreement form completed in full
~ Post Dated Volunteer Bond Cheque

Erin Auto Recyclers
Erin Auto Recyclers is a family run business that has been operating since 1958. Owned and operated by Rob Smith, Elayne McSkimming & their 2 sons, Erin Auto Recyclers along with their employees work hard to ensure that vehicles are recycled properly. Erin Auto Recyclers are proud to be recognized by the Clean Air Foundation as the first in Canada to recover mercury switches from ABS breaking assemblies. Recovering ABS assemblies along with convenience lighting switches is an important achievement because such assemblies often contain three mercury switches that together contain over 2.5 grams of mercury, a harmful neurotoxin. These assemblies can also take more time to find and remove from end of life vehicles than other switches, proving that Erin Auto Recyclers is dedicated to their company mission of continuously moving forward and improving upon everything that affects the environment and quality of life.
